Top Reasons Why You Should Hire A Trinidad Real Estate Agent

  1. Expertise and Knowledge: Real estate agents are trained professionals who have a deep understanding of the local real estate market. They can provide valuable insights into current market conditions, property values, and neighborhood trends.

2. Access to Listings: Real estate agents have access to a wide range of listings through various real estate agents groups, social media and many other industry networks. This allows them to find properties that meet your specific criteria more efficiently than if you were searching on your own.

3. Negotiation Skills: Negotiating the price and terms of a real estate transaction can be complex. Real estate agents have experience in negotiation and can help you get the best deal possible, whether you’re buying or selling.

4. Paperwork and Legal Compliance: Real estate transactions involve a significant amount of paperwork and legal documentation. Real estate agents can ensure that all documents are completed accurately and in compliance with local and state regulations, reducing the risk of legal issues.

5. Time Savings With Real Estate:

Buying or selling a property can be time-consuming, especially when dealing with showings, inspections, and negotiations. Real estate agents can handle many of these tasks on your behalf, saving you time and reducing stress.

6. Market Insights: Agents can provide you with information about the local real estate market’s historical performance and future outlook, helping you make informed decisions.

7. Marketing and Exposure: When selling a property, real estate agents can market it effectively, using professional photography, online listings, and their network of potential buyers. This can lead to a quicker sale and potentially a higher selling price.

8. Network of Professionals: Agents often have a network of trusted professionals, including inspectors, appraisers, mortgage brokers, and attorneys, that they can recommend to assist with various aspects of the transaction.

9. Handling Issues: If unexpected problems arise during the buying or selling process, real estate agents can provide guidance and solutions to help you navigate these challenges.

10. Peace of Mind: Working with a real estate agent can provide peace of mind, knowing that you have a knowledgeable and experienced advocate working on your behalf throughout the transaction.

11. Prevent Fraud: Registered agents would have been certified by Roytec or a certified institution. A registered company with legal affairs that can be found online. FIU registered and can be verified on their list

How to find a reliable real estate agent in Trinidad

  1. Online Search: Use search engines or real estate websites to look for agents in Trinidad. Websites like TNTHomesforsale.com , Mybunckofkeys, PinTT or local real estate portals often have directories where you can find agents.
  2. Local Real Estate Agencies: Contact local real estate agencies in Trinidad. They can provide you with a list of their agents, and you can choose one based on your preferences and needs.
  3. Referrals: Ask friends, family, or colleagues who have recently bought or sold property in Trinidad for recommendations. Personal referrals can be valuable in finding trustworthy agents.
  4. Social Media: Look for real estate agents or agencies on social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, or LinkedIn. Many professionals and agencies have social media profiles where they showcase their services and listings.
  5. Attend Open Houses: Visit open houses in Trinidad. This allows you to meet real estate agents in person and get a sense of their expertise and professionalism.
  6. Check Reviews: If you find agents online, read reviews and testimonials from their previous clients. This can give you insights into their work ethics and customer satisfaction.
  7. Licensing and Credentials: Ensure that the agent you choose is licensed and has the necessary credentials. You can usually check this information on official real estate licensing websites in Trinidad.
  8. Interview Multiple Agents: Don’t hesitate to interview multiple agents before making a decision. Ask about their experience, recent transactions, and their knowledge of the local market.

Can a US citizen buy property in Trinidad and Tobago? ›

Can foreigners buy property in Trinidad & Tobago? Yes, foreign nationals can buy property in Trinidad & Tobago. According to the Foreign Investment Act of 1990, non-citizens are permitted to purchase up to 1 acre of land (1 parcel) for residential purposes or up to 5 acres of land for commercial purposes.

What is the cost to build a 3 bedroom house in Trinidad? ›

To make it easy, we will use a case study that describes a three-bedroom single-story home (1500 sq. ft) on one lot of flat land (5000 sq. ft) with an approximate construction cost of $ 975,000.00 (in Trinidad) and $ 1,125,000.00 (in Tobago). Do you pay property taxes in Trinidad and Tobago? ›

All 'land' in Trinidad and Tobago is subject to property tax. Land under the Property Taxes Act (PTA) is broadly defined to include land covered with water and all buildings, structures, machinery, plant, pipelines, cables, and fixtures erected or placed upon, in, over, under, or affixed to land.

How long do you have to live in Trinidad to become a citizen? ›

Applicants petition the Minister responsible for immigration, who considers whether the applicant has adequate knowledge of the English language; and has resided within the territory, worked for the government, or has combined residency and government service for eight years.

Why are houses so expensive in Trinidad and Tobago? ›

The Trinidad and Tobago real estate market's fortunes have long been tied to those of the oil sector. Between 1991 and 2006 house prices more than quadrupled as the country's hydrocarbons and petrochemicals industries grew strongly.
